## Cleaning-Crew Access — Harlow Point Building

The contracted cleaning team from Brightmoor Services enters through the east service door between 22:00 and 02:00. Night-shift staff should expect them on floors 2 through 5 on weeknights only. Do not prop the service door open; it alarms after ninety seconds. If the crew arrives without their supervisor, verify against the roster pinned in the security office. The service door accepts the standard after-hours pass, listed below for night-shift reference.

turnstile pass: bdg-NG-3

**Break-Glass: Siftwall Bloom Filter**

Hey, new folks — Siftwall is the bloom filter sitting in front of our key-value store. If it starts rejecting valid keys and on-call can't reach an owner, you can break glass: this bypasses the filter and hits the store directly. Expensive, so log it. Unlock the bypass console with the recovery passphrase below.

strongbox words: aldax-istox-sorion-isteth-gilion-tamius-norok-aldax-fraox-wenius

Leadership review briefing, finance copy. Subject: Ostrander Group term sheet. Key points: minority stake, two-year exclusivity in the Kelverton market, milestone payments tied to Pellan platform integration. Legal flags the termination clause as one-sided; we're pushing back. Valuation assumptions need your model run by Friday. No signatures until the review clears. One confidential item on forward plans appears immediately below.

board note of fahif-yahog: Gross margin on Wenath came in at 10 percent against a plan of 5 percent. Only 3 of the 100 pilot accounts renewed Wenath, so a churn review is set for July 15.

Handover — Pellick functions. Cold starts on the serverless handlers spiked after Tuesday's runtime bump; p99 init is ~4s on the Dornvale region. I've added a warmer that pings each handler every five minutes, which masks most of it, but the checkout path still sees occasional slow starts during traffic spikes. Roll back the runtime if it worsens overnight. For reference, the handlers are deployed with these configuration values.

deployment values, taweg-bajop:
[fenvan]
port = 5672
team = holmir
host = fenvan.orvexio.example
region = lower-1
access_code = ac_b98bc6
timeout_ms = 1500